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
88998517905 32860460928 2498808632
6507477 2516186 08661101
6507477 2516186 08661101
141 72182413748 46
All about undefined
Interested in learning more?
6507477 2516186 08661101
141 72182413748 46
See more
7145 585605
99124 8277 130
See more
2499219507 43786 818934
918713 8608351197 09
See more